반응형
Chat GPT란
OpenAI에서 만든 인공지능 챗봇이다.
텍스트 기반으로 대화하고, 질문에 답하거나 정보를 제공할 수 있으며, 프로그래밍, 글쓰기, 번역, 학습 도우미 역할도 할 수 있고, 다양한 주제에 대해 이야기할 수도 있다.
📌 ChatGPT의 주요 특징
1️⃣ 텍스트 기반 대화
- 자연스러운 대화를 유지하면서 맥락을 이해하고 이어갈 수 있어.
2️⃣ 다양한 주제에 대한 지식
- 프로그래밍: 여러 언어(C, Python, JavaScript 등)로 코드 작성 및 디버깅 가능
- 학문적 지식: 수학, 과학, 역사, 철학 등 다양한 분야의 개념 설명 가능
- 일반 상식: 뉴스, 트렌드, 취미, 여행 등 광범위한 정보 제공 가능
3️⃣ 논리적 사고 및 문제 해결
- 논리적인 설명을 제공하고, 복잡한 개념을 쉽게 풀어 설명
- 알고리즘, 데이터 구조, 수학 문제 등 논리적 사고가 필요한 질문에도 답변가능
4️⃣ 창의적인 글쓰기
- 스토리 작성, 블로그 글, 시, 광고 카피 등 창작 활동도 가능
- 문장을 자연스럽게 다듬어 주거나 번역도 가능
5️⃣ 코드 실행 기능
- 간단한 파이썬 코드 실행이 가능해서, 수학 계산이나 데이터 분석 가능
- 하지만 일부 기능(인터넷 검색, 파일 다운로드 등)은 제한
6️⃣ 기억력이 없음
- 대화가 종료되면 내가 했던 말을 기억하지 못함
- 하지만 같은 대화 내에서는 맥락을 유지할 수 있음
7️⃣ 항상 최신 정보를 알지는 못함
- 2024년 6월까지의 정보는 기억하고 있지만, 그 이후의 정보는 내가 직접 검색하지 않으면 모를 수도 있음
- 필요하면 웹 검색 기능을 사용해서 최신 정보를 찾아볼 수도 있음
📌 ChatGPT를 잘 활용하는 방법
1. 원하는 답변을 정확하게 받는 방법
- 구체적으로 질문하기 → "JavaScript에서 배열을 정렬하는 방법?"보다는 **"JavaScript에서 숫자로 이루어진 배열을 오름차순으로 정렬하는 방법이 뭐야?"**라고 질문하면 더 정확한 답을 받을 수 있다.
- 예제나 배경 설명 추가하기 → 코드 관련 질문이라면 "이런 코드를 작성했는데, 오류가 나. 왜 그런 걸까?" 같이 예제를 주면 더 좋은 답변을 얻을 수 있다
- 목적을 설명하기 → 단순히 개념을 알고 싶은 건지, 프로젝트에 적용하고 싶은 건지 말해주면 더 적절한 답변을 얻을 수 있다
2. 코딩 도움 받기
- 코드를 작성해줄 수도 있고, 오류를 해결하거나 성능을 개선하는 방법도 알려준다
- "이 코드에서 for문 대신 while문으로 바꿔줘"처럼 구체적인 요청을 하면 원하는 방식으로 답을 받을 수 있다
- "내가 만든 함수가 너무 느려, 최적화할 수 있을까?" 같은 성능 개선 질문도 가능하다
3. 글쓰기 & 문서 정리
- 이메일, 보고서, 문서 요약, 블로그 글 등도 가능하다
- 초안을 작성하고 수정 요청하면 원하는 형태로 다듬어줄 수 있다
- "이 글이 너무 딱딱한데 좀 더 부드럽게 바꿔줘" 같은 말투에 대한 요청도 가능하다
4. 학습 & 정보 검색
- 어려운 개념을 쉽게 설명해 달라고 요청하면 이해하기 쉽게 풀어줄 수 있다
- 비교가 필요한 경우 → "React와 Vue의 차이점이 뭐야?"
- 예제를 원하면 → "Python의 리스트 컴프리헨션을 예제 코드로 보여줘"
5. 반복 작업 자동화
- 엑셀 수식, 간단한 코드 자동화, 정규식 작성 같은 반복 작업도 가능하다
- 예를 들어 "이 문자열에서 숫자만 추출하는 정규식을 만들어줘" 같은 요청이 가능하다
'생성형AI > chatGPT' 카테고리의 다른 글
chatGPT를 이용한 나의 공부계획표 만들기(챗지피티 활용법, 무료버전, 유료버전) (0) | 2025.04.05 |
---|---|
chatGPT를 전문가로 이용해보았다(챗지피티에게 잘 물어보는 방법, 무료버전, 유료버전) (0) | 2025.04.05 |
chatGPT로 요즘 유행하는 그림 그리는 법(지브리스타일, 챗지피티로 그림 그리는법, 유료버전, 무료버전) (1) | 2025.04.03 |
chatGPT는 어떻게 사용해야할까? (0) | 2025.04.01 |
Chat GPT 사용하기 (2) | 2025.03.31 |